Honeymoon Gift Scheme

We provide a honeymoon gift scheme, which allows your family and friends to contribute to your honeymoon as a wedding gift. The scheme works as follows:-

  • When you are ready to send out your wedding invitations, contact us and we will provide cards for you to send to your guests advising how they can contribute.
  • Your guests will then contact us and we will credit your account and log a message, which will appear with their contribution.
  • Guests can contribute up to any amount in multiples of £5.
  • They can pay by debit card or credit card, but if they want to pay by credit card we will have to charge them 2% (we will indicate this on the cards).
  • We will then deduct the amount they have paid from your final holiday balance (due 10 weeks prior to your departure).
  • Guests will be able to contribute up until a week prior to your return from honeymoon.

In addition to sending you the honeymoon cards we will then contact you on two separate occasions:

  1. We will send you a list of who has contributed what and a list of their attached messages a week prior to your departure.
  2. We will also send you a cheque on your return from honeymoon for all the contributions made after the payment of your final balance. This will also include a final list of everyone who has contributed (together with any new messages).
